Ok, This park is one of the cheapest, most reliable parks in all of central Ohio. There is no age restrictions and costs 15 dollars. There are 5 fields and all are on low maitenance. Does it really matter? There are things to hide behind, and buildings to go into. Their speedball course was just recently tripled in size and has watertile to hide behind. There is tall grass you can lay down in. You can play on the Bunker/Woods field. This field filled with scraps of fences and trees, pointed different directions. Camoflauge is a must have in this course. Directly next door in the Haunted Hoochie. This is the same Haunted Hoochie that Fran Bar Park holds for an amusement in October. There is lots of building to hide behind and is by far their largest field. It often turns into close range paintball because the buildings are made up of large tunnels with sharp turns. The scenery in Hoochie is amazing whihc makes playing in it fun. The Junkyard is large and filled with broken things. Its fun. The last is behind the woods/bunker and is called the "Back Woods." It is just woodball and some rocks. Very fun if you are woodball fan. There are no ref's, you are basically free to do what you want. If there is a problem with someone there such as stolen materials, you can tell the owners of the park and they will end their membership. If you are a new paintballer this is the place to go. They give you a Tippmann Pro Carbine as a rental gun which is decent. They fill Co2 and if you run out of paint there is a store across the street. This is just a friendly cheap Paintball Course.
